RUFFINI, Martha. The return of Peronism to power: Memory and politics in northern Patagonia (1973-1976). Rev. Pilquen. secc. cienc. soc. [online]. 2017, vol.20, n.4, pp.96-109. ISSN 1851-3123.

In Argentina access to the Historic Third Peronism (1973-1976) meant the end of the Prohibition Party and leader Juan Domingo Peron. This created a true "Peronist spring", which translated upward social mobilization role of youth, armed groups and violent confrontation between Peronist party factions. The North Patagonia politically formed a unique space. In Río Negro, Governor Mario Franco tried to maintain governance and reconfigure the historical memory by inserting the justicialism as the dominant force, creating a pantheon in which the heroes and dates of Peronism were included.

Keywords : Peronism; Memory; Patagonia; Violence.
